Explore examples of summarizing, drawing an idea, asking questions, and …Jul 7, 2016 · However, when we are talking about studying using elaboration, it involves explaining and describing ideas with many details. Elaboration also involves making connections among ideas you are trying to learn and connecting the material to your own experiences, memories, and day-to-day life. Spacing or spreading out learning opportunities over time improves learning. For example, students will learn and retain more if they study 30 minutes M-F, rather than for 2.5 hours all on ...Elaboration involves making connections between new information and related information retrieved from prior learning. used as a cognitive learning strategy to improve the storage and retrieval of new information.
